Mesothelioma

MyBacklink86 - Mesothelioma is a lung cancer that is quite rare, but the most dangerous and deadly that usually occurs in the membrane around the lungs, which called the pleura. The main cause of cancer that attacks lung cells called mesothelium is exposure to asbestos dust.

Asbestos can be in the form of roofing boards, minerals, fibers and various kinds of processed asbestos products that can cause dust and are inhaled along with the air. Usually this occurs in industrial settings, construction sites, carpentry and building material stores. When asbestos fibers and dust are inhaled into the lungs, the dust will stop in the lungs.

If you constantly breathe in asbestos dust, the dust will collect and settle in the lungs. This is the cause of cancer and the risk will increase if you are an active smoker or have a family history of cancer.

This cancer will be very deadly because of the patient's average survival time for Mesothelioma cance or malignant mesothelioma ranges from 4 to 18 months, and about 10 percent of patients live at least five years after being diagnosed.

Types of Mesothelioma Cancer

  • Pleural mesothelioma (pleural mesothelioma), which is cancer that attacks the lining of the mesothelium of the lungs (pleura). This type is the type that occurs most often.
  • Mesothelioma peritoneum (peritoneal mesothelioma), namely mesothelioma in the lining of the abdominal cavity (peritoneum).
  • Mesothelioma pericardium (pericardial mesothelioma), which is mesothelioma that attacks the protective lining of the heart organ.
  • Mesothelioma testis (testicular mesothelioma), which is mesothelioma which attacks the protective layer of the testes or testicles.

Symptoms of Mesothelioma

  • Dyspnea and nonpleuritic chest wall pain are the most common symptoms of malignant mesothelioma, (About 60-90% of patients experience chest pain or dyspnea symptoms).
  • In patients with malignant mesothelioma, the physical findings of pleural effusion are usually recognized by percussion and auscultation.
  • In rare cases, malignant mesothelioma manifests as cord compression, brachial plexopathy, Horner's syndrome, or superior vena cava syndrome. Death is usually caused by infection or respiratory failure from the development of mesothelioma.
  • The main areas that often occur in the pleura (87%), peritoneum (5.1%), and pericardium (0.4%).

Diagnosis of Mesothelioma

Apart from the history and symptoms, further tests are done to diagnose mesothelioma, including X-rays to check if there are abnormalities in the chest and CT scans to check the chest and stomach area. Biopsy using a small fine needle or by laparoscopy or thoracoscopy is also very helpful for permanent diagnosis.

Management of Mesothelioma

Some mesothelioma treatments that are generally done are chemotherapy and radiotherapy. Surgery is performed to remove cancer which is generally still in the early stages of development of the disease, although in some cases it still fails to completely remove cancer cells.

6 Places to See Pink Muhly Grass in Korea

6 Places to See Pink Muhly Grass in Korea, Apart from Haneul Park
Photo: livingnomads.com

MyBacklink86 - Autumn generally presents us with a natural view of red and brownish yellow. But different from others, South Korea actually adorns some of their natural areas with pink plants in autumn. The plant is known as pink muhly grass and Haneul Park is one of the hot spots to see pink muhly in South Korea.

The original name for this muhly grass is Muhlenbergia capillaris, which comes from America and grows in many parts of the eastern part of the United States, from Missouri to Massachusetts. This pink muhly grass also grows in parts of southern Florida.

Launching from the page of The Korea Herald , pink muhly grass appeared for the first time in a private park on Jeju Island in 2014. Since then, several cities in South Korea have planted muhly grass seedlings in large areas, along rivers, and in parks. . It is said that this Muhly grass can grow and adapt easily to various types of soil.

2. Huerre Park on Jeju Island
Huerre Park on Jeju Island

Huerre Park is a national park on Jeju Island. In this park, visitors can do horse riding activities or pick up oranges while looking at the pink muhly grass.

In addition, Huerre Park also hosts The Huerre Pink Muhly festival every year which usually takes place from September to November.

The estimated admission ticket to Huerre Park is 13,000 Korean Won for adults, 11,000 Korean Won for teenagers, 10,000 Korean Won for children 2 years and over.
